Netanyahu’s actions in Gaza ‘amount to genocide,’ says Scottish leader – Middle East Monitor
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ter



The First Minister of Scotland, John Swinney, condemned the planned Israeli occupation of Gaza City, labeling it as genocide and urging the UK Government to take immediate action, including recalling Parliament and sanctioning Israel. His remarks followed Israel’s Security Cabinet approval of a plan to occupy Gaza City, amidst ongoing devastation and significant Palestinian casualties since October 2023.
